Troubleshooting: Errors in Management Center after you upgrade to 8.0.3.1

If you are on Mod Pack 3 Fix Pack 1 (8.0.3.1), you might encounter the following errors in Management Center.

  • When you open the layout list from Commerce Composer, you might encounter the following error in your log file:
    0000015c GetDataHandle W com.ibm.commerce.foundation.internal.client.taglib.GetDataHandler execute() No data-type
    definition found for com.ibm.commerce.pagelayout.facade.datatypes. LayoutType in get-data-config.xml.
    0000015c ServletWrappe E com.ibm.ws.webcontainer.servlet.ServletWrapper service SRVE0014E: Uncaught service() exception root cause
    /jsp/commerce/pagelayout/restricted/GetPageLayouts.jsp: com.ibm.websphere.servlet.error.ServletErrorReport: javax.servlet.jsp.
    JspException: No data-type definition found for com.ibm.commerce.
    pagelayout.facade.datatypes.LayoutType in get-data-config.xml.
    ...
  • When you attempt to read content pages within Management Center, you might encounter the following errors in your log file:
    000000fc GetDataHandle W com.ibm.commerce.foundation.internal.client.taglib.GetDataHandler execute() No
    expression builder has been configured with the name: "getAllPages".
    000000fc ServletWrappe E com.ibm.ws.webcontainer.servlet.ServletWrapper service SRVE0014E: Uncaught
    service() exception root cause 
    /jsp/commerce/pagelayout/restricted/GetContentPages.jsp: com.ibm.websphere.servlet.error.ServletErrorReport: javax.servlet.jsp.
    JspException: No expression builder has been configured with the name:
    "getAllPages".
          at org.apache.jasper.runtime.PageContextImpl.handlePageException
    (PageContextImpl.java:732)
          at com.ibm._jsp._GetContentPages._jspService(_GetContentPages.
    java:173)
          at com.ibm.ws.jsp.runtime.HttpJspBase.service(HttpJspBase.java:99)
          at javax.servlet.http.HttpServlet.service(HttpServlet.java:668)
          at com.ibm.ws.webcontainer.servlet.ServletWrapper.service
    ...

Problem

The wrong get-data-config.xml file was included in 8.0.3.1.

Solution

Upgrade to a newer 8.0.3.x fix pack or 8.0.4.x fix pack. For information about the latest fix packs, see List of available maintenance packages.